TinyProxy搭建
yum -y install tinyproxy
# 如果沒有安裝成功,應該是找不到這個包
# 執行以下操作即可
yum install -y epel-release
yum update -y
# 編輯配置文件
vim /etc/tinyproxy/tinyproxy.conf
兩個配置:
1、自定義開放端口
注意:如果您選擇在低於1024的端口上運行,則需要使用root用戶啓動tinyproxy。
所以建議大於1024
Port 10240
2、添加允許的網段或主機,如果要允許所有,註釋掉即可
Allow 127.0.0.1
3、隱藏掉Via請求頭部,去掉下面的註釋
DisableViaHeader Yes
python驗證
執行下面代碼,返回值200,請求成功
import requests
proxy = {"http" : "98.142.137.92:10240"}
res = requests.get('http://baidu.com',proxies=proxy)
print(res.status_code)